Azerbaijani parliament begins next plenary meeting
The next plenary meeting of the Azerbaijani Parliament kicked off on Tuesday.

Speaker Ogtay Asadov congratulated Mehriban Aliyeva on her appointment as first vice-president on behalf of the MPs, AzVision.az reports.

Asadov said Mehriban Aliyeva made a great contribution to the development of legislation with her parliamentary activity. “Mrs. Aliyeva is the author of 4 amnesty acts applied to 10,000 prisoners. Thus, she brought joy to thousands of families. Moreover, Mehriban Aliyeva played a key role in the development of inter-parliamentary relations with the United States and France. People have an exceptional respect for her as the President of the Heydar Aliyev Foundation,” he said.

The speaker noted that this appointment will bring new breath to the country's socio-political life. “We believe that Mrs. Aliyeva will render great service to her people in this position as well,” she said.

The meeting's agenda includes 13 issues, including annual report of Azerbaijani Human Rights Commissioner (Ombudsman).
